Aquilegia clematiflora Green Apples Columbine features an exceptional flowering display of fully double, spur-less, saucer shaped blossoms. Creamy white blossoms begin their starry showcase in early summer, as clear green apple opening buds, fading to swoony luminous white as they mature. The flower blooms dance above gray-green foliage with finely divided leaves on plants that average 24" inches. Hardy down to zone 3, this flowering perennial will freely self seed and naturalize into a woodland setting with ease. This variety prefers well drained soil with half day sun exposure or dappled sun all day. Packet: 50 seeds.
